    i'm using some shaped terries i got from ebay - just as easy as disposables as they still fasten with velcro. they seem to be growing with baby aswell! i love the motherease wraps as they have poppers so are easier to fasten on a baby who is rolling over / trying to get up then the velcro ones! having said that the cotton bottom wraps are also good. hubby refuses to use them tho - if baby needs changing when i not here he puts a disposable on!! don't get it as they are just as easy to use! men!
